Output 51bdbea79ecbdd9c805d8d772caa26494ae64718b18bc8145f5d889fe33d1dc2:3

value
12278614
script pubkey
OP_0 OP_PUSHBYTES_20 066c64d2d5fbe47fcb277965be6dbefc4923f1ce
address
bc1qqekxf5k4l0j8lje809jmumd7l3yj8uww7xj8te
transaction
51bdbea79ecbdd9c805d8d772caa26494ae64718b18bc8145f5d889fe33d1dc2
spent
true